Summary
Born deaf in Washington state; attended hearing and oral schools but never learned to speak, then went to the Washington State School for the Deaf, graduating there and then graduating Gallaudet College in 1960. Worked at the Boeing Company for 9 years until he went to the Leadership Training Program for the Deaf, after which he took a new job as a counselor, student advisor, and an instructor at Seattle Central Community College. When his wife went off to college for her master's degree, he was forced to cook for himself, and learned about and got hooked on wine tasting and collecting. He dug out a wine cellar underneath his home by hand.
